STEM-Project based Learning in Physics Concept of Measurement to Enhance High School Students' Scientific Literacy
Students' scientific literacy in understanding physics concepts still needs to improve. This study aims to determine scientific literacy using STEM Project-based Learning (PjBL) in learning physics, especially measurement concepts. The study used the Classroom Action Research (CAR) method with...
